Pinch Of Pistachio vs Sourdough
Both are PPG colors. Pinch Of Pistachio reads as beige-greige, while Sourdough reads as beige — two distinct hue families, not close cousins. At LRV 71 vs 62, Pinch Of Pistachio will read as the brighter of the two — a 9-point gap that matters most in north-facing or low-light rooms. At ΔE 6.7, the difference is perceptible but not dramatic — the two can work harmoniously in the same space.
